Irina Shevel wrote: 14 Apr 2023, 15:07 For the detention system, is there a record sort of thing? SO would it go on a record that I got one or could I just get one, have fun with it and not worry?
There's no such thing as a "formal" IC record, it's more like, get into trouble a few times people will remember you as a troublemaker IC and it might affect how people see your character. You won't have any mechanical disadvantage from it though. That only changes when you do something so bad it gets you expelled, which affects site access, progress opportunities, and the adult system (not yet released).

As for the IP thing.

Yes, if you are in the same location you will likely have the same IP. However schools are unique in that yes, at school I would see a shared IP but I would also see unique IP addresses associated with you both as you also access the site from your home PC, if you use cellphone data to log on, etc.

As for detention. A player is not their character. There is a fine line with this, if you are making choices to elicit discomfort purposefully in others oc, that would be a problem and would get you labeled as a trouble-maker. Writing is often a collaborative exercise and being the cause of a problem is not a bad thing, it gives people something to roleplay.
